> So anyway, I now have this ultra whizzbang high performance logging API and
> I am aware of some deficit in the logging performance of Maven, so I spin
> up a private fork (it could be a hidden private fork, or it could be a
> public one... doesn't matter) and integrate the logging API and low and
> behold I see a whopping X% improvement... so I want to bring that back to
> Maven...
>
> Is there anything wrong with the above?


 I say absolutely not. Where things can go wrong is what happens next.
If someone commits that giant chunk with no discussion, then that's
probably going to raise concerns. If instead a discussion is started
to discuss the work and decide if it's appropriate to pull in, then
fine.
